So I just finished 'Venom' #35, and honestly, that ending was a lot to process. Eddie's been through the wringer, right? The final confrontation with Bedlam is this wild psychic battle inside Eddie's mind, with Dylan trying to help from the outside. It ends with Eddie seemingly sacrificing himself to contain Bedlam's essence, collapsing into a dormant, cocoon-like state.
What really got me was the last few pages. Dylan is left holding what looks like a dormant symbiote, unsure if his dad is even alive in there. And then that final splash page: Meridius, the future version of Eddie from the King in Black timeline, just... watching. It's a massive 'oh crap' moment. The setup is clearly moving past the Bedlam arc and back into the whole time-traveling, dynasty-of-Eddies war that's been brewing. The next story seems to be about Dylan stepping up, Meridius making his move, and figuring out if Eddie can come back from being a living prison.
